Abstract

PURPOSE:To achieve correct correspondence between the input and output current, by connecting the emitter of the first and second transistors in which the bases are mutually connected to the voltage supply source and connecting the collectors to the emitters of the fourth and third transistors. CONSTITUTION:The emitters of the transistors 1, 2 connecting the bases mutually are respectively connected to the voltage supply source Vcc, and the emitters of the transistors 4, 3 connected to the bases are respectively connected to the collectors. The bases and the collectors of the transistors 2, 4 are connected one another. The input current Iin is fed to the collector of the transistor 4 and the output current Iout is obtained from the collector of the transistor 3. With this constitution, the collector to emitter voltage of the transistor 1 is almost equal to the collector to emitter voltage of the transistor 2, allowing to make equal the collector currents ic1 and ic2 of the transistors 1, 2. Accordingly, the current amplification rate of each transistor is sufficiently greater and the base current is neglected, then ic1=ic4=Iin, ic2=ic3=Iout are obtained and Iin=Iout is made possible.
